Popular places to visit
Gravensteen Castle
One of the only remaining medieval castles in Flanders, this historic fortress provides a fascinating insight into the weaponry, culture, and drama of Ghent’s past.
Saint Bavo Cathedral
One of the iconic Three Towers of Ghent, this historic cathedral is known for its outstanding collection of art.
Belfry of Ghent
Visit one of Ghent’s most famous attractions, an imposing tower that defines the city’s skyline and symbolizes its independence.
Ghent Town Hall
See one of the city’s most unusual landmarks, a striking building constructed over the course of almost four centuries.
St. Nicholas' Church
A beautiful example of Scheldt Gothic architecture, this striking blue-gray church is among the oldest landmarks in the city.
Citadel Park
This popular public park is among the most important green spaces in the city, home to pleasant paths and several unique museums.
